How to Make Creamy Crack Chicken Gnocchi
Now that we have all our ingredients, it’s time to roll up our sleeves and get cooking! This Creamy Crack Chicken Gnocchi comes together in a delightful symphony of flavors. Just follow my steps, and you’ll have a comforting dinner ready in no time!
Step 1: Cook the Gnocchi
Start by boiling a pot of salted water. Drop in the gnocchi and cook according to package instructions. You’ll know they’re done when they float to the top, which takes about 2-4 minutes. Drain and set aside, giving you plenty of soft pillows for the delicious sauce to embrace!
Step 2: Cook the Bacon
Next, grab a large skillet and heat it over medium heat. Toss in the chopped bacon and cook until crispy and golden. This usually takes about 5-7 minutes. Once it’s done, remove it from the skillet and set it aside, leaving a little bit of that glorious bacon fat behind for flavor. Trust me; it adds magic!
Step 3: Prepare the Chicken
In the same skillet, season your diced chicken with salt, pepper, paprika, and onion powder. The seasoning boosts the flavors! Add the olive oil and butter to the hot skillet, then cook your chicken until it’s golden brown and fully cooked, which should take around 5-6 minutes. You want it tender and juicy—no one likes dry chicken!
Step 4: Add Garlic
With the chicken cooked to perfection, it’s time to add the minced garlic. Stir it in and let it cook for about a minute until fragrant. Garlic is the heart of this dish, bringing out the richness of the cream sauce and inviting warmth to the meal. You don’t want to skip this step!
Step 5: Create the Creamy Sauce
Reduce the heat to low and stir in the softened cream cheese and heavy cream. Then, add the shredded cheddar and grated Parmesan, mixing until everything is smooth and creamy. That beautiful sauce will hug every piece of gnocchi and chicken, making it wonderfully rich!
Step 6: Combine Gnocchi and Bacon
Now it’s time for the fun part! Gently fold in the cooked gnocchi and crispy bacon into the creamy sauce. Toss everything together until the gnocchi is well-coated and every bit of bacon finds its way back into the dish. It’s a moment worth savoring!
Step 7: Garnish and Serve
To finish this delightful dish, sprinkle some chopped green onions and fresh parsley on top. It not only adds color but also a burst of freshness that lifts the creamy richness. Serve hot, and watch as your loved ones dig in! This dish is bound to win hearts and create smiles.
Tips for Success
- Prep your ingredients before you start cooking. It makes the process smoother and more enjoyable!
- Don’t overcook the gnocchi; they’ll turn mushy. Watch for that float!
- Using cold cream cheese? Soften it in the microwave for a few seconds.
- Feel free to customize with veggies like spinach or mushrooms for added nutrition.
- Store leftovers in an airtight container, and reheat on low heat to keep the creaminess.

PrintCreamy Crack Chicken Gnocchi
- Total Time: 40 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ings 1x
- Diet: Low Calorie
Description
Creamy Crack Chicken Gnocchi is a comforting dish made with tender gnocchi, chicken, and a rich creamy sauce featuring bacon, cheese, and garlic.
Ingredients
- 1 lb (450 g) gnocchi
- 2 large chicken breasts, diced
- 4 slices bacon, chopped
- 1 cup cream cheese, softened
- ½ cup heavy cream
- ½ cup shredded cheddar cheese
- ¼ c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 tsp onion powder
- ½ tsp paprika
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- 2 tbsp butter
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 2 green onions, chopped, for garnish
- Fresh parsley, chopped, for garnish
Instructions
- Cook gnocchi according to package instructions, drain, and set aside.
- In a large skillet, cook chopped bacon over medium heat until crispy. Remove and set aside, leaving a small amount of bacon fat in the skillet.
- Season diced chicken with salt, pepper, paprika, and onion powder. In the same skillet, heat olive oil and butter, then cook chicken until golden brown and fully cooked, about 5–6 minutes.
- Add minced garlic and cook for 1 minute until fragrant.
- Reduce heat to low and stir in cream cheese, heavy cream, cheddar, and Parmesan until smooth and creamy.
- Add cooked gnocchi and bacon back to the skillet, tossing to coat evenly with the creamy sauce.
- Garnish with green onions and fresh parsley before serving. Serve hot.
